Product description
The third book in the Pig series of chapter books in diary form – with Pig’s hilarious illustrations on every page.Pig, Duck, Cow and all the Sheeps are far away from their Farm and beloved Vegetarian Farmers. More fun, parps, slops and unbelievable adventure from this much-loved set of characters.
- children will laugh themselves silly with Pig’s unique voice, terrible grammar, and super funny illustrations throughout each book.

Pig To The Rescue!
This book was our first encounter with Pig and his friends, and we immediately warmed to him! This is a lovely story about the value of friendship and not giving up on each other. A fun read with a lot of silly humour, which went down well! (But be warned, you may need some calming down time after the fits of giggles! Pig can be rather crude...) Pig's adventures are most certainly out of the ordinary; so too are the wonderful characters he encounters along the way, from the flamboyant but misunderstood Ki-Ki the fashion loving fickle turkey, to the irrefutably evil Ivanna. After Pig's best friend, Cow, is kidnapped, he and Duck set out on a perilous rescue mission. Guided (or perhaps misguided?) by the crazy Ki-Ki, they've got to retrieve their pal, before she is turned into a handbag! Great discussion followed the story, in particular about friendship and forgiveness, and animal cruelty. A great read to share, and the children can't wait to hear the next instalment of Pig's diary. Highly recommended!
